Cloud Service Provider (CSP)
Commonly used in Cloud Computing, Networking
A cloud service provider (CSP) is an organization that delivers computing resources, such as network services, infrastructure, or business applications, over the internet. These services are hosted in data centers and are accessible to companies or individuals through network connections. CSPs enable users to access and manage resources remotely without needing to own or maintain physical hardware.
How It Works
A cloud service provider maintains large-scale data centers equipped with servers, storage systems, and networking equipment. They offer various services, such as virtual machines, storage solutions, databases, and application hosting, which clients can access via internet-based interfaces. Customers typically interact with these services through web portals, APIs, or management consoles, allowing for scalable and flexible resource provisioning. The CSP manages the underlying infrastructure, including hardware maintenance, security, and updates, while users focus on deploying their applications or services.
The services are often delivered on a pay-as-you-go basis, enabling clients to scale resources up or down based on their needs. This model reduces upfront capital expenditure and allows for rapid deployment of new services or applications, leveraging the CSP’s infrastructure and expertise.
Common Use Cases
- Hosting websites and web applications to ensure reliable and scalable access for users.
- Storing and backing up data securely in the cloud for disaster recovery and data management.
- Running enterprise applications such as customer relationship management (CRM) or enterprise resource planning (ERP) systems.
- Providing development and testing environments that can be quickly provisioned and decommissioned.
- Delivering software as a service (SaaS) solutions like email, collaboration tools, or analytics platforms.
Why It Matters
For IT professionals and certification candidates, understanding what a cloud service provider offers is fundamental to designing, deploying, and managing modern IT environments. CSPs enable organisations to leverage scalable, flexible, and cost-effective infrastructure without large capital investments. Mastery of cloud services is increasingly essential as many roles involve cloud architecture, security, and operations. Recognising the capabilities and limitations of CSPs helps professionals optimise resources, ensure security, and meet compliance requirements in cloud-based deployments.